Measles outbreak in England and Wales

Another outbreak in England and Wales has raised the concerns and worries of the health officials in the region and it is none other than the measles attack.

The figures released from the Health Protection Agency have confirmed that the cases of measles have almost doubled in England and Wales in only the first six months of 2012 as compared to the last year’s figures.

According to the referred data, 964 measles cases have been reported during this year’s first six months whereas the number of cases was 497 in the first half of 2011.

Considering the issue crucial, the HPA has already started urging parents to get their children vaccinated with the measles, mumps and rubella vaccine (MMR) to avoid their ward from being affected. Schools will begin in September and thus the authority has requested the parents to take the actions prior sending their child to school.

Measles is a serious illness, which can cause complications like meningitis and brain inflammation. Pregnant women are also at high risks of measles because catching the disease during pregnancy can born their babies with birth defects.

Dr. Mary Ramsay, head of immunisation at the Health Protection Agency, said: "Measles can be very serious and parents should understand the risks associated with the infection, which in severe cases can result in death."
